Wife of the president Aisha Buhari, has pointed to the aftermath of the election loss by the PDP in 2015 as reason for Ekiti State governor, Ayodele Fayose’s continuous fusillade of attacks against her person.
Ms Buhari once engaged the governor in a Twitter battle, before hurriedly deleting the tweets. Fayose also vowed that Ms Buhari can’t set foot in the United States where the enforcement authorities will be waiting for her for fraud perpetrated under the Halliburton scam. But Ms Buhari checked into Washington DC this week, where she’ll be spending a week.
In a chat with the VOA, Ms Buhari said Fayose couldn’t stop abusing her after the election. Fayose had initiated a full scale media and propaganda war against the Buharis during a bitter electioneering season.
“All these started during the campaign period. He was not the only who was abusing me, others did that, but after the election, which Allah made us to win, and they to lose, everybody kept quiet, but Fayose kept on abusing people and eventually he started abusing me too,” she said.
“I don’t know those places and people he mentioned”, she said of the Halliburton scam.
Ms Buhari also added that God made her husband’s election victory possible and urged Fayose to deal with it. She has since initiated legal proceedings against Fayose on account of the allegations and told the VOA, she’ll continue to fight the governor in court.
“I never chose myself for this post, but God chose it for me. I am not even the one who contested election.
“I have never abused him; I don’t even know him as a person. How can he be accusing me of what I have no idea of? I won’t let this go.”
